Types Of Bulk Packaging-Solutions
Bulk packaging-solutions come in various forms, each tailored to specific needs. One popular option is bulk bags, often made from woven polypropylene. These are ideal for transporting dry goods like grains and chemicals.
Another common choice is drums, which can securely hold liquids or powders. They provide excellent protection against external elements and are easily stackable.
Totes represent a versatile solution as well. Often used for both solid and liquid materials, these containers offer reusability that benefits the environment.
For lightweight items, corrugated boxes serve a practical purpose. They’re easy to handle while still providing adequate strength during transit.
Flexible packaging offers adaptability, with options such as pouches or films that conform to product shapes. This flexibility optimizes storage space while maintaining product integrity throughout distribution channels.

Challenges and Limitations of Bulk Packaging
Bulk packaging offers many benefits, but it also comes with challenges that businesses must navigate.
- One major limitation is the initial investment. Transitioning from traditional to bulk packaging can require significant upfront costs. Companies may need new equipment and staff training, which can be daunting.
- Logistics pose another challenge. Handling large quantities demands careful planning in storage and transportation. If not managed well, it could lead to inefficiencies or product spoilage.
- Regulatory compliance is crucial too. Specific industries have strict guidelines regarding material safety and labeling. Ensuring adherence while switching to bulk formats can complicate operations.
- Consumer perception also plays a role. Some customers prefer retail-ready packages they recognize over bulk options, affecting market acceptance.
Waste management becomes critical. While bulk packaging aims for sustainability, improper disposal methods can undermine these efforts if end users do not handle them correctly.
